I remember back when I was young and my parents would tell me fanciful stories about the apocalypse to scare me. I would spend hours playing video games that placed me in post apocalyptic worlds and I had to "learn" how to survive, as if the designers even knew what life after the apocalypse would be like. Upon looking back I realize how ignorant much of my generation was in using our resources wisely. The majority of us grew up getting everything we wanted and never thought we would have to learn to survive on our own. Most people don't remember how the war started, all we remember is when the moon stopped and our world became tidally locked. Then there was the period of mass confusion, people fleeing the side of our world that would soon be covered in ice and trying to find room on the side that would slowly be burned to death. In many ways the countless who perished had it easy, they would not have to go through the wars and death that took place in the immediate aftermath of the Great Shift. Now the earths population is just a fraction of what it once was. The majority of the population lives in the small "Comfort" zone in between the desert and eternal ice. There existence is a pitiful shadow of what they once had, enslaved to a few warlords they must work endlessly to make enough food to live. Then there are the few people like me. Whether we were forced to leave the "Comfort" zone or left on our own free will our lives are the same: Survive.

My newest build, just a quick vignette mainly to show off the wall technique I used for the dark red wall. I haven't seen it used like this before, and I thought it was pretty cool because it allows for walls to be made in different colors and be variable in their bend and lengths to some extent, making it quite easy to implement into different areas. During the pre-apocalypse, when things first start going down-hill, normal security forces become virtually useless. As the world takes a turn for the worst, the civvies start taking drastic measures to survive.
High power dictators and leaders need a means of protection incase a riot or uprising takes place. Normal security forces are no longer capable of withholding these crazed civilians, that's where these guys come in...
Ghost is the close quarters expert. He generally stays directly in contact with the target, and ensures no one gets near enough to cause any harm.
Alex is the assault specialist. He stays within shooting distance of Ghost, and generally is the first on the field if a riot needs suppressing.
Robert is the team sniper. He usually positions himself high enough to survey all of the target zone. He is also sufficiently trained for close quarters fire-fight situations.
